Pagini recente » Cod sursa (job #1648561) | Cod sursa (job #3183074) | Cod sursa (job #3283787) | Istoria paginii runda/111/clasament | Cod sursa (job #2978697)
#include <fstream>
#include <iostream>
using namespace std;
ifstream fin("fact.in");
ofstream fout("fact.out");
int p, n;
int nr0(int n) {
if (n < 0) return -1;
else {
int k = 0;
for (int i = 5; n/i >= 1; i *= 5)
k += n/i;
return k;
}
}
int main() {
fin >> p;
if (p < 0)
fout << -1;
else
for (int i = 1; i <= 10e8; ++i)
if (nr0(i) == p) {
fout << i;
break;
}
return 0;
}